Results of the Great CAYC Bake-off

Published 10:18 on 18 May 2020

Star Bakers of the Virtual CAYC Bake Off

14 bakers took part in the first Virtual CAYC Bake Off on Saturday 16th May. The standard was incredibly high and the creativity of all the cakes and muffins really impressed the judges (although also extremely sad to not be able to actually taste them!) Thank-you to the organisers Margaret, Jo and Kathryn for putting together this fun evening that brought members (young and old) together! If you missed out, fear not! Another night will be organised in the coming months.
Our two Star Bakers - Sara Carse and Luke Simpson - will be receiving their prizes shortly, and will hopefully share a photo modelling them! In the meantime, admire their winning creations. Luke created a Victoria sponge (with homemade jam!) in the shape of a Topper sail, decorating with raspberries, blueberries and a grape! Sara also baked a Victoria sponge, with a jam and buttercream filling and finished with CAYC-themed fondant icing motifs, including boats, dolphins, waves and crabs. Masterpieces!
